8 Tips for Sleeping Soundly in the Winter


As we hit a cold-snap, it’s important to keep warm in bed during the night. Here are Cannock Beds’ top tips:

1.    Keep your bedroom warm – not tropical hot – and ensure there are no draughts

2.    Use an underblanket to keep heat in your bed, and turn your mattress to its soft and warmer ‘winter’ side if it has one.

3.    Use many blankets to create layers of warm trapped air in your bed. You can always take away some of these layers if you get too hot.

4.    Buy a duvet with a high tog rating. They’re more expensive, but warmer!

5.    Under your duvet, try wearing pyjamas or a sleeping shirt made of natural materials.

6.    If you’re still cold under those layers, either use a covered hot water bottle or an electric blanket, which can even regulate your temperature throughout the night.

7.    Before you go to bed, try some mild exercise to get your blood flowing.

8.    Enjoy a hot, non-caffeinated drink and a relaxing bath.
